Interesting case - Simon Kolton KC (DHCJ): W granted charging order for unpaid spousal and child PPs. Fixed costs regime (CPR 45.23) applies to family cases meaning only fixed costs of £110 are recoverable unless court 'orders otherwise' (it did) caselaw.nationalarchives.gov.uk/ewhc/fam/202...

Brazil nuts, almost unique in our food supply, are not cultivated, but are collected in the wilds of the Amazon forest. Communities of indigenous nut harvesters maintain intact forests necessary for the trees. When you eat Brazil nuts, you are contributing to the conservation of Amazon forests. 🌏

The grave of my favourite poet, John Keats, in the Protestant cemetery in Rome. At his own request his name wasn't included and he wrote his own epitaph: 'Here lies one whose name was writ in water', because he felt he'd left no impact on the world. #AlphabetChallenge #WeekIForItaly
